While exploring Vaishno Devi, take some time to visit the Baba Dhansar Temple, located about 15 km from Katra. This hidden gem is known for its natural waterfalls, lush green surroundings, and the Shiva Lingam formed by the waterfall. It offers a tranquil escape from the bustling shrine area and allows you to connect with nature. Another local favorite is the Shiv Khori Cave, situated 70 km from Katra. This cave temple is dedicated to Lord Shiva and features natural formations resembling various deities. It provides a unique spiritual experience and showcases the natural wonders of the region.
